Comprehending Xeriscaping

Xeriscaping is a landscaping technique that originated in deserts and has actually gotten popularity in water-conscious communities like Ft Collins. The term "xeriscape" is stemmed from the Greek word "xeros," implying completely dry, and "scape," referring to a sight or scene. At its core, xeriscaping goals to develop aesthetically attractive landscapes that require minimal water, fertilizer, and maintenance.

Concepts of Xeriscaping

1. Water Preservation: Xeriscaping focuses on minimizing water use by picking drought-tolerant plants, improving dirt top quality, and executing reliable irrigation approaches.

2. Drought Tolerance: Xeriscape yards are made to thrive in dry conditions, with a focus on selecting plants adjusted to the neighborhood environment and dirt problems.

3. Dirt Renovation: Healthy and balanced soil is necessary for water retention and plant growth in xeriscape landscapes. Integrating raw material and compost helps enhance soil structure and wetness retention.

4. Appropriate Plant Choice: Xeriscape gardens feature a diverse selection of plants that are well-suited to the regional climate and require minimal irrigation when established.

5. Effective Irrigation: Xeriscape gardens use water-efficient irrigation systems, such as drip watering or soaker tubes, to deliver water directly to the origin area of plants, decreasing dissipation and runoff.

Designing a Xeriscape Yard

Assessing Your Landscape

Prior to embarking on a xeriscape project, evaluate your landscape to establish elements such as sunlight direct exposure, soil kind, and existing vegetation. Understanding these conditions will certainly assist you select ideal plants and layout aspects for your xeriscape garden.

Picking Drought-Tolerant Plants

Choosing the right plants is vital for a successful xeriscape yard. Select indigenous and drought-tolerant types that are adapted to the environment and soil problems of Fort Collins. Take into consideration aspects such as water requirements, fully grown size, and seasonal passion when selecting plants for your xeriscape yard.

Incorporating Hardscape Elements

Hardscape components, such as pathways, patio areas, and keeping wall surfaces, play an essential duty in xeriscape design. Select durable and water-efficient products, such as crushed rock, rock, and specialty rock, to produce aesthetically enticing hardscape functions that enhance the natural appeal of your xeriscape yard.

Executing Reliable Irrigation

Efficient irrigation is essential for water conservation in xeriscape yards. Take into consideration installing a drip irrigation system or soaker pipes to supply water directly to the root zone of plants, lessening dissipation and runoff. Mulch can likewise assist preserve moisture in the soil and decrease the requirement for regular watering.
